Why Choose a Comfy Fabric Sofa?
Fabric sofas use a variety of advantages that make them a popular option for many house owners. Here are some reasons why one may pick a material sofa over other types:
| Advantages | Description |
|---|---|
| Comfort | Material sofas are often softer and more inviting than leather or other products, making them perfect for relaxing nights in. |
| Variety | Material sofas come in a myriad of colors, patterns, and textures, enabling house owners to select a style that complements their decoration. |
| Breathability | Fabric is more breathable than leather, which can become sticky or hot. This is specifically beneficial in warmer environments. |
| Alleviate of Maintenance | Many material sofas are resistant to stains, and detachable covers are frequently washable, making cleaning much easier. |
| Cost | Generally, material sofas tend to be more budget-friendly than leather choices. |

Table: Popular Fabric Types and Their Features
| Fabric Type | Functions |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cotton | Soft, breathable, and available in numerous colors. | Comfortable and simple to tidy. | Prone to wrinkling and stains. |
| Linen | Textured and elegant look. | Extremely breathable and elegant. | Can be quickly harmed and discolorations. |
| Microfiber | Made from artificial fibers. | Durable, stain-resistant fabric. | Can attract pet hair and dust. |
| Velvet | Luxurious feel and rich colors. | Soft and aesthetically sensational. | More expensive and requires upkeep. |
| Polyester | Artificial and flexible fabric. | Easy to clean and long lasting. | Might not be as breathable. |
Care and Maintenance of Fabric Sofas
To make sure that your material sofa stays relaxing and inviting for many years to come, appropriate care and upkeep are essential. Here are some 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Vacuum the sofa regularly to eliminate dust and debris. Use a soft brush attachment to prevent harming the fabric.
Spot Treat Stains: For spills, act rapidly by blotting the stain with a clean cloth. Depending upon the fabric, you can utilize a mild detergent or material cleaner recommended by the manufacturer.
Turn Cushions: If your sofa has detachable cushions, consider rotating them routinely. This assists in even wear and extends their lifespan.
Prevent Direct Sunlight: To avoid fading, place your sofa far from direct sunshine.
Professional Cleaning: Consider having your sofa professionally cleaned up every number of years, especially for fabrics like linen and velvet that require specific care.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. For how long do material sofas normally last?
The life-span of a material sofa can vary widely based on the quality of products and building and construction. Usually, you can expect a good-quality fabric sofa to last between 7 to 15 years.
2. Are fabric sofas helpful for homes with family pets?
Yes, but it's vital to select a resilient fabric. Microfiber or securely woven materials are often more resistant to pet wear and tear.
3. How do I remove pet odors from my fabric sofa?
Sprinkling baking soda on the sofa and letting it sit for a couple of hours before vacuuming can help absorb odors. You can also use fabric fresheners developed for upholstery.
4. Can I reupholster my old material sofa?
Yes, reupholstering is a practical alternative if you desire to revitalize an old sofa. It can be more cost-effective than buying a new one, especially with high-quality frames.
5. What is the best fabric for a family sofa?
For households, resilient fabrics like microfiber or polyester blends are recommended. They provide stain resistance and are easy to tidy, making them ideal for high-traffic areas.
